In the gritty underbelly of Tokyo, rookie detective Natsuo finds himself drawn to his enigmatic senior partner, Kirino—a lone wolf whose cold exterior hides a troubled past. When a routine convenience store robbery spirals into a dangerous confrontation, the two are forced to work together, and Natsuo's innocent infatuation gives way to a raw, consuming attraction. As they close in on the culprit, buried secrets and unspoken desires explode to the surface, blurring the line between justice and obsession. This 2001 Japanese pink film blends noir-style crime with unflinching eroticism, exploring first love in the most extreme circumstances. With a relentless pace and explicit sensuality, *Hard Duty* is a visceral dive into the dark side of desire—where duty and passion collide, and no one walks away unscathed.
